Output 89ac7fa6506338de97214988be83c4692427cfacacb956dbf34a141ed660ca3d:1

value
3113478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70343aad2344b048a37a0cb15739442b6318b82e OP_EQUAL
address
3BvJAyeZi5VEYgtF6LveUmuBgZv61xxu8N
transaction
89ac7fa6506338de97214988be83c4692427cfacacb956dbf34a141ed660ca3d
spent
true